Description:
We are looking for a highly skilled Financial Analyst to join our clients’ advisory firm, which specializes in fractional CFO services, M&A advisory, and Private Equity. Companies often engage their CEO as an interim CFO to prepare for mergers, acquisitions, and investments, or to lead complex projects involving multiple firms. The successful candidate will collaborate with the CEO to develop financial models, conduct analysis, create client presentations, and assist with financial reporting. This role provides a unique chance to work closely with the founder, who is a seasoned finance professional and will advance into a more senior role over time.
- Part-time: 16 hours per week (will grow into a full-time position)
- Remote job
- Working hours: Flexible (between 9 am - 6 pm CET)
- Monthly Starting Salary: Open, depending on level of experience
- Starting date: ASAP
REQUIREMENTS:
- Master’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field.
- At least 5 years of experience in M&A, Corporate Finance, Private Equity, or Venture Capital.
- Advanced proficiency in financial modeling.
- Strong understanding of accounting principles, numbers, balance sheets, and P&L statements.
- Highly experienced with Excel and PowerPoint.
- Proficiency in data analysis.
- Basic legal understanding of various corporate structures and international business operations.
- Commercially minded with a strong business acumen.
- Excellent communication and presentation skills.
- A proactive and diligent work ethic, demonstrating the highest levels of integrity and reliability.
- CFA certification (plus).

Responsibilities:
TASKS & R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Build and maintain complex financial models.
- Conduct thorough financial analysis and data interpretation.
- Prepare detailed spreadsheets and reports.
- Create compelling presentations using PowerPoint to communicate insights and strategies to clients.
- Assist in financial reporting and the preparation of balance sheets, P&L statements, and other financial documents.
- Collaborate on M&A, private equity, and venture capital projects.
- Apply a basic legal understanding of different types of companies and international structures to analyses.
- Continuously seek to understand the business to provide commercial insights.
